Someone reportedly slipped up at Sega, posting notes on a private meeting with Sony that mentions Playstation 2 and Dreamcast emulation on the Playstation 3. The meeting notes, dated Aug. 6, 2009, were hosted on what appeared to be a Sega of America press site, though they have since been removed. In the document, it’s said that Sony wants to sell “all PS2 titles on PSN,” as well as a special Japanese import section with pricing of $9.99 to $39.99 for a full game. In addition, the notes say Sega could offer Dreamcast games to the Playstation Network, with Sony picking from a list of titles for “a long period of exclusivity.” This would be a cool service for people new to the Playstation brand, but it’d be a slap in the face for PS3 owners who never got the backwards compatibility they were once promised. [via Edge]
